Output ae66f85e6d72008b00cc81de6d93d9a0c9f44d642837dacfb643959f2ba0129a:2

value
45000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8631f8077b0b0a33a33cebf4e8fe72144a3c16d OP_EQUAL
address
3H3NBxjjskojC4tuzVuf1EtP6t2CUw9MMT
transaction
ae66f85e6d72008b00cc81de6d93d9a0c9f44d642837dacfb643959f2ba0129a